LAST CALL FOR APPLICATIONS: APEX 2026-2027 LEGACY PROJECT
Each year, the Greater Kansas City Chamber of Commerce Centurions Leadership Program plans, leads, and mobilizes Centurions volunteers to complete a Legacy Project for one Kansas City nonprofit, with the intent to bring a long-lasting benefit to the Kansas City community. Do you know of a local non-profit interested that could benefit from this opportunity? This opportunity is open to all area non-profits!
The deadline for the Legacy Project Application is Friday, May 8.
PINNACLE
CENTURIONS INFORMATION SESSION
THURSDAY, May 7 | 9-10 A.M.
The Greater Kansas City Chamber of Commerce’s Centurions Leadership Program is a two-year program focused on building community awareness through civic opportunities and on community issues that affect Greater Kansas City. The mission is to prepare a representative cross-section of the community’s emerging leaders for their role in shaping the future of Greater Kansas City. Interested professionals around the Greater Kansas City region can attend our next information session on Thursday, May 7, from 9:00-10:00 a.m. at Build Wyco to learn more about the program.

FROM CONFLICT TO COLLABORATION
THURSDAY, MAY 28 | 8:30-10:00 A.M.
In this session, From Conflict to Collaboration, Haley Grayless shows leaders how to approach conflict with curiosity and courage. You’ll learn a simple framework to address tension called the Conflict Pendulum, speak up with confidence, and turn challenging conversations into opportunities for connection and growth. This session equips Centurions to strengthen relationships by clearly communicating expectations and respectfully holding each other accountable.
Haley Grayless, MSOD is a leadership and team culture consultant with a master’s degree in organizational development. She helps organizations build strong leaders who cultivate healthy, productive cultures within their teams where people want to do great work. Register here >>
